#A62CB0 Hex Color Code

#A62CB0

The Hexadecimal Color #A62CB0 is a contrast shade of Dark Orchid. #A62CB0 RGB value is rgb(166, 44, 176). RGB Color Model of #A62CB0 consists of 65% red, 17% green and 69% blue. HSL color Mode of #A62CB0 has 295°(degrees) Hue, 60% Saturation and 43% Lightness. #A62CB0 color has an wavelength of 434.25926n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A62CB0 is #CC33C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A62CB0 is #A3A. The Closest Color to #A62CB0 is #9932CC. Official Name of #A62CB0 Hex Code is Violet Eggplant.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A62CB0 is 6 Cyan 75 Magenta 0 Yellow 31 Black and #A62CB0 CMY is 6, 75,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A62CB0 is hsl(295,60,43,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(295, 75, 69).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A62CB0 is 24.46, 13.04, 42.3.
Hex8 Value of #A62CB0 is #A62CB0FF. Decimal Value of #A62CB0 is 10890416 and Octal Value of #A62CB0 is 51426260. Binary Value of #A62CB0 is 10100110, 101100, 10110000 and Android of #A62CB0 is 4289080496 / 0xffa62cb0.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A62CB0 is 0.307, 0.163, 0.163 and YIQ Color Space of #A62CB0 is 95.526, 30.2882, 66.8814.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A62CB0 is 16.66, 5.18, 41.85.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A62CB0 is 42.82, 64.49, -44.51.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A62CB0 is 42.82, 46.85, -72.43.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A62CB0 is 42.82, 78.36, 325.39. Hunter Lab variable of #A62CB0 is 36.11, 57.71, -44.17.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A62CB0

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
